Commercial Slab Installation in Columbia, SC

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s for various types of property projects, including foundations for retail spaces, warehouses, parking areas, and other commercial structures. This process ensures a stable and level base that supports the building’s weight and provides durability over time. Property owners typically seek this service when constructing new commercial facilities or upgrading existing structures, and they often want to understand the scope of work, the materials used, and the suitability of the slab for their specific project needs.

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the area, soil conditions,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It’s also important to clarify the intended use of the slab, as this can influence the thickness, reinforcement, and finishing requirements. Proper planning and communication about these details can help ensure the completed slab meets the structural and functional needs of the property.

FAQ

Commercial Slab Installation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installations are often used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on business properties.

What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, chosen for its durability and strength, with options available for specific project needs.

Why is proper site preparation important for commercial slabs? Proper site preparation ensures a stable foundation, reduces the risk of cracking, and extends the lifespan of the slab.

What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? It’s important to assess the intended use, load requirements, and any local building codes to ensure the slab meets project needs.
